[英]Possible to force a migration from the command line?
我昨天在迁移中犯了一个菜鸟错误。 我修改了已经上传并运行的迁移,我忘记在上传新版本之前回滚。 现在,迁移失败了,因为列已经存在(向上)或者没有要删除的列(向下)!
是否有可能从控制台获取迁移以强制进行一次更改, 而不 :force => true
在文档中写入:force => true
,迁移,然后再次删除它?
回到稳定状态的一种简单方法是在数据库中手动更改添加列以使回滚工作,然后执行回滚并再次向上迁移。
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.